8. Dyed Easter Eggs

This is a kid-friendly Easter decor idea. Dyeing Easter eggs with shaving cream is a lot of fun and it looks really interesting. It is a cute Easter egg decor.
The materials needed are shaving cream, dyeing containers, white eggs, liquid food coloring, coffee stirrers, paper towels, and tongs.

26. Egg String Lights

These look so cute together and even more beautiful at night. We decorate it a week before Easter and it stays for an entire Easter week. This sets the mood for the festivity.
The supplies required are a block of wood, plastic eggs, a drill and LED string lights. Use LED lights not the usual bulbs as they can cause damage to the plastic eggs.

28. Bright Easter Eggs

It is one of the best dyed Easter eggs. There is no dripping so that means it’s a clean craft not messy like it used to be when I dyed the eggs couple of years ago.
The supplies required are vinegar, cooking oil, hard boiled eggs and food coloring. Once you dye the eggs put them on a paper towel and let them dry. It is a beautiful Easter egg table decor.

32. Colored Deviled Eggs

This is one of the easiest Easter decor ideas. You require hard-boiled eggs, dye them with different colors, cut the egg in half and remove the yolk from each of the eggs. Dye eggs with a a mix of water, vinegar and food coloring.
Keep the eggs on a glass plate on the Easter table. They will look like a beautiful centerpiece. It is one of the best Easter table decorations.
